Массив заполнен сразу
const a: array[1..8] of integer=(4,-2,-4,0,2,3,1,5);
var i:integer;
begin
for i:=1 to 8 do
if a[i]=2 then writeln('Pozitciya elementa ravnogo 2 = ',i);
end.
Массив заполняется с клавиаутры
var
a: array[1..8] of integer;
i:integer;
begin
for i:=1 to 8 do
readln(a[i]);
for i:=1 to 8 do
if a[i]=2 then writeln('Pozitciya elementa ravnogo 2 = ',i);
end.
Информацией,команды из окружающего мира называются информацией,
Ответ: число 2.
Объяснение: (4 - 2) * 4 * 4 - 2 - 2 = 28
//Pascal
var
x, y: real;
begin
write('x = '); readln(x);
if x > 100 then
y := 5 * x + 6
else
if ((x >= 10) and (x <= 100)) then
y := 200 * x
else
if x < 10 then
y := x / 2;
writeln('y = ', y);
end.
Uses crt;
const max=100;
var a: array [1..max] of real;
i,n:integer;
begin
clrscr;
write('Zadajte razmernost massiva');
readln(n);
writeln('Ishodnij massiv:');
for i:=1 to n do
begin
a[i]:=random(100);
write(a[i]:7:2);
end;
writeln;
writeln('Novij massiv:');
for i:=1 to n do
begin
if (i mod 2)<>0 then
a[i]:=sqrt(a[i]);
write(a[i]:7:2);
end;<span>
end.</span>